Peoria Post Acute And Rehabilitation
Peoria Post Acute And Rehabilitation is a 4-star rated nursing home in Peoria, AZ with 179 beds. CMS sub-ratings: health inspections 4/5, staffing 1/5, quality measures 5/5.
The facility has 21 health violations on record. Federal fines total $12,430 across 2 enforcement actions. Most recent inspection: December 15, 2022.
